WebDec 20, 2024 · Health effects of mould exposure include a runny or blocked nose, irritation of the eyes and skin, and sometimes wheezing. For people with asthma, inhaling mould spores may cause an asthma attack. Very rarely, people may develop a severe mould infection, usually in the lungs. WebJul 2, 2024 · The most common black mold symptoms and health effects are associated with a respiratory response. Chronic coughing and sneezing, irritation to the eyes, mucus membranes of the nose and throat, rashes, chronic fatigue and persistent headaches can all be symptomatic of black mold exposure or black mold poisoning. In addition to the many health problems mold can cause, research suggests that mold exposure may also compromise sleep. In one large study, household molds were correlated with increased sleep problems like insomnia, snoring, and excessive daytime sleepiness. Another study of nearly 5,000 adults found …
